嘿,小伙伴们,今天咱们聊聊“大数据分析平台”和“免费”。你知道吗?现在有很多免费的开源工具可以帮助我们搭建一个功能强大的大数据分析平台,而且这些工具真的很好用!
首先,我们得知道一些基础知识。在大数据分析中,数据清洗是第一步,也是最重要的一步。我们需要确保数据的质量,这样才能得到准确的分析结果。接下来,让我们看看如何使用Python中的几个库来实现这个目标。
我们要使用的库有Pandas(用于数据处理)和NumPy(用于数值计算)。这两个库都是免费的,并且非常流行。我们还会用到Matplotlib库来进行数据可视化,这样我们可以更直观地看到数据的特点。
好了,让我们开始吧!首先,安装这些库:
pip install pandas numpy matplotlib
然后,我们可以通过读取CSV文件来获取数据。假设我们有一个名为`data.csv`的文件,里面包含了我们要分析的数据。下面是一个简单的例子:
import pandas as pd # 加载数据 data = pd.read_csv('data.csv') # 查看数据前几行 print(data.head())
接下来,我们可能需要清洗数据。比如删除缺失值或重复项:
# 删除含有缺失值的行 cleaned_data = data.dropna() # 删除重复项 cleaned_data = cleaned_data.drop_duplicates()
最后,我们可以对数据进行分析。例如,计算某个字段的平均值:
# 计算某一列的平均值 mean_value = cleaned_data['your_column'].mean() print(f"平均值: {mean_value}")
当然,如果你想要看看数据的分布情况,可以使用Matplotlib进行可视化:
import matplotlib.pyplot as plt # 绘制直方图 plt.hist(cleaned_data['your_column'], bins=20) plt.title('数据分布') plt.xlabel('值') plt.ylabel('频率') plt.show()
总之,通过使用这些免费的开源工具,你可以轻松搭建并运行自己的大数据分析平台。这不仅节省了成本,还让你能够更加灵活地控制你的数据和分析过程。